About German
German is a West Germanic language that has been documented since the 8th century in the form of Old High German. It underwent significant standardization through Martin Luther's Bible translation in the 16th century, which helped unify numerous regional dialects. Approximately 132 million people speak German today.
German uses the Latin alphabet with the addition of the umlaut vowels and the eszett character. It is the official language of Germany, Austria, and Liechtenstein, and a co-official language in Switzerland, Belgium, and Luxembourg. German is famous for its ability to create extremely long compound words, with Donaudampfschifffahrtsgesellschaftskapitan being a classic example meaning captain of the Danube Steamship Company.
